Zebu Grill, located at 92nd Street between 1st and 2nd Avenues, is a Brazilian restaurant with tasty food and luscious cocktails. At around $12, these are fabulous drinks that every friend or date will be impressed with. All drinks on the impressive cocktail menu were created by their mixologist, Rodrigo Chamon. Two top-selling favorites are the Caipifruta and the Caipi-Samba (twists on the famous Brazilian drink, the Caipirinha). The Caipifruta is a choice of fresh mango, cashew, passion fruit, guava
or lemon with Leblon cachaça with a good shake, and the Caipi-Samba is muddled mint and lime with strawberry liqueur and Leblon cachaça. These drinks are a real hit! Cheers!
